[PATCH 2/2] tracing/workqueue: Use %pf in workqueue trace events

From: Frederic Weisbecker
Date: Tue Sep 22 2009 - 18:18:48 EST


From: Anton Blanchard <anton@xxxxxxxxx>

Using %pf instead of %pF supresses printing of the function offset
which will always be 0 in the case of worklet functions.
